The work of an Employee Health Services Coordinator is integral to Canadian Blood Services’ role as Canada’s Lifeline. In this role, you will be engaged in the continuous improvement of processes and systems that enable effective disability management at Canadian Blood Services (CBS), under the direction of the Manager. You will act as an advisor and coordinator to Management, People, Culture and Performance and individual Employees in Sites, Departments, Regions, Program areas, and external clients on employee health, disability and attendance case management, EAP, medical surveillance, National Wellness programs and First Aid. This will include a mixture of occupational and non-occupational files.

**Key responsibilities include**:

- Assess, analyze, and evaluate case information to determine fitness to work and accommodation needs by following a systematic, goal-oriented approach.
- Demonstrate effective team meeting leadership skills by collaborating with external providers and internal providers such as Human Resources, Supervisors, Managers, Health and Safety Coordinators, and Ergonomists to facilitate successful return to work or work modification.
- Participate in a consulting, advisory capacity to provide professional judgment and knowledge to recommend appropriate accommodation when necessary and identify and solve return to work barriers.
- Assist in developing and implementing a comprehensive wellness program with organizational participation to recognize and support both individual employee health and the organizational environment by workplace health interventions.
- Maintain and continually improve a comprehensive attendance management program by participating in early intervention to provide expert advice, guidance, and attendance support to recommend whether a health condition supports ongoing absences or if accommodation through modified work/hours is appropriate.
- Under the guidance of the Manager, develop, coordinate, and implement the National Influenza Vaccination primary prevention program. Present options for the structure and delivery, plan, and direct marketing, develop evaluation methodologies and processes to evaluate the effectiveness of the program and submit recommendations as required.
- Coordinate and monitor the medical surveillance program by identifying possible health hazards and appropriate recommendations to ensure occupational health and compliance with legislative requirements or with best practices in disease prevention.
- Performs other related duties and projects as required.
